Getting your first car is an exciting milestone, but finding the right auto insurance can be overwhelming, especially when trying to keep costs manageable. Here are some strategies to help you secure affordable auto insurance in the United Kingdom specifically for your first car.
1. Understand the Types of Coverage
Before shopping for auto insurance, it's essential to familiarize yourself with the different types of coverage available. In the UK, car insurance is typically categorized into three main types: third-party, third-party fire and theft, and comprehensive. Third-party insurance is the minimum requirement and the cheapest option, but it provides limited coverage. Comprehensive insurance, while more expensive, offers broader protection, including damage to your own vehicle. Weigh the pros and cons based on your budget and needs.
2. Compare Insurance Quotes
Use comparison websites to gather multiple quotes. Sites like Comparethemarket, MoneySuperMarket, and Confused.com allow you to input your details and compare quotes from various insurers. This step is crucial in finding the best deal and ensuring you’re not overpaying for coverage.
3. Choose a Smaller, Safer Vehicle
The type of car you drive significantly impacts your insurance premium. Smaller, safer vehicles generally have lower insurance costs. Insurance companies take into account factors such as the car's age, engine size, and safety rating when calculating your premium. If you’re still considering which car to buy, look for models known for being economical to insure.
4. Increase Your Excess
Consider higher voluntary excess in exchange for lower premiums. The excess is the amount you pay out of pocket in case of a claim. By increasing this amount, you'll often receive a lower premium. However, ensure that the excess is still affordable for you in the event of an accident.
5. Maintain a Clean Driving Record
New drivers are generally viewed as higher-risk clients, but maintaining a clean driving record can help lower your insurance costs over time. Avoid speeding tickets, accidents, and other violations, as these can result in increased premiums.
6. Take a Driving Course
Participating in advanced driving courses, such as Pass Plus, can enhance your driving skills and sometimes qualify you for discounts on your insurance. Insurers often reward drivers who demonstrate competence by taking additional driving courses.
7. Utilize Discounts and Promotions
Many insurance providers offer discounts for various reasons: being a student, having multiple policies, or using telematics devices. Look for policies that offer "black box" insurance where your driving is monitored, as responsible driving can lead to lower premiums.
8. Insure with a Parent or Guardian
If you have a parent or experienced driver willing to add you to their policy, this can significantly lower your insurance costs. Despite being on their policy, you will still be covered, and it can build your driving history as you gain more experience.
9. Shop Around Every Year
Insurance premiums can change annually; therefore, it’s beneficial to review your policy and compare new quotes each year. You might find better deals that fit your budget as you gain more driving experience.
